Dear Essie,
Help! I just cracked a nail and can't get to a salon. What can I do?

It's always sad when you have ten perfect nails and one starts to break. Here's what you can do to save that nail and prevent it from breaking further.
Cut a small strip from an unused tea bag and cover the break using Essie's '3-way glaze' or nail glue if you have some. The '3-way glaze' will glue the tea bag fabric over the nail and act as an instant patch. Add the topcoat and voila! Your nail will be as good as new.


Dear Essie,
Ouch! I just got a horrific paper cut on my index finger that really smarts. What can I do?

You can place a small drop of base or topcoat to seal the cut. It will sting a little when first applied, but after the cut has been sealed, it won't hurt anymore!

Dear Essie:
I like to let my nails 'go bare' sometimes, but they are an ugly yellow color. Is there something that I can use to get my nails looking healthy again?

There are many things that can discolor nails, for instance, using harsh household cleaners can be a leading culprit. Be sure to use gloves and keep those hands and nails protected from chemicals. A little secret I use is to apply the peel of fresh lemon or grapefruit to discolored nails. The citric acid will help remove the yellow color from nail surfaces. Also, use our special 'non-yellow topcoat' on your next manicure to help prevent the nail color from turning. Special ingredients help protect nail color from harmful UVA/UVB rays. Think of it as sun block for your nails And ladies, please, whether you're washing dishes, the dog or the car, put those gloves on. Your hands and nails will thank you!

Also remember, your nails are not tools. Do not use your nails in place of screwdrivers, pliers or wire strippers. No matter how tough you think your nails might be; nothing is more likely to ruin a perfect 10 than using them as a paint scraper!
